SLS 18RS-507 ORIGINAL 2018 Regular Session SENATE BILL NO. 332 BY SENATOR CORTEZ TRANSPORTATION/DEV DEPT. Requires district offices of the Department of Transportation and Development to publish on the internet information regarding projects within the district. DIGEST SB 332 Original 2018 Regular Session Cortez Proposed law requires each DOTD district office to publish daily on DOTD's internet website information by parish regarding the daily work schedules and work assignments of district employees related to design, construction, traffic engineering, and maintenance work being performed by district employees, including but not limited to the following: (1)A description and location of the project or maintenance work performed. (2)The original start date of the construction or maintenance work. (3)The estimated date that the work is to be completed. (4)The number and classification of district employees engaged in the work. Effective August 1, 2018. (Adds R.S. 48:94) Page 2 of 2 Coding: Words which are struck through are deletions from existing law; words in boldface type and underscored are additions.
